Finisterre is a cool, surf-oriented outdoor clothing company from Cornwall, UK, for whom we have a lot of respect. And so it seems does Britain’s Royal Society for the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als (RSPCA), for they’ve nominated Finisterre as Small Company Fashion Finalists in their 2009 Good Business Awards.
